What Is the Process for Undergoing a Vitamin D Blood Test?
The vitamin D blood test involves the collection of a small blood sample, typically taken from a vein in your arm. A qualified healthcare professional usually carries out this straightforward procedure within a clinical environment. After the sample is collected, it is sent to a laboratory for assessment, where your vitamin D levels are measured in nanomoles per litre (nmol/L). This efficient process ensures minimal interruption to your daily routine.
During the procedure, patients often receive clear instructions, which may include specific preparations to follow beforehand. Although the test is minimally invasive, some individuals might experience slight discomfort from the needle. Who Should Seriously Consider Vitamin D Testing?
People at risk of vitamin D deficiency should strongly consider undergoing testing. This group typically includes individuals with limited sunlight exposure, such as office workers or those living in northern regions of the UK, particularly during the winter months. Other demographics who may benefit from testing include those with darker skin tones, as higher melanin levels can hinder the skin’s ability to produce vitamin D from sunlight. Additionally, certain medical conditions, including obesity, specific gastrointestinal disorders, and kidney diseases, may also necessitate testing.
Discussing your risk factors with your doctor can help determine if a vitamin D blood test is necessary for you. Regular testing is crucial for anyone exhibiting symptoms of deficiency, such as fatigue, muscle weakness, or ongoing bone pain. Early detection of deficiencies allows for timely interventions, including dietary changes or vitamin D supplementation, ultimately improving overall health and helping to prevent long-term complications.

What Insights Can You Gain from Your Vitamin D Test Results?
Vitamin D test results are reported in nanomoles per litre (nmol/L), offering crucial insights into your vitamin D status. Typical levels generally fall within the range of 50-125 nmol/L. Understanding your position within this spectrum can inform your supplementation and lifestyle choices. If your levels are below 50 nmol/L, you may be categorised as deficient and may need supplementation.
Comprehending the implications of your results is vital. For example, levels that are below the recommended range could elevate your risk of various health issues, including weakened bones and increased susceptibility to infections. Conversely, excessively high levels can present risks, highlighting the need for a balanced approach to vitamin D intake. What Should You Expect During the Testing Procedure?
During the vitamin D blood test, a healthcare professional will collect a small amount of blood from your arm, typically from a vein located in the crease of your elbow. The procedure is quick, often taking just a few minutes, and usually involves minimal discomfort. Many patients describe the sensation as akin to a light pinch.
Once the blood sample is collected, it is carefully labelled and dispatched to a laboratory for analysis. What Are the Common Symptoms Indicating Vitamin D Deficiency?
Signs of vitamin D deficiency can often be subtle but may manifest as bone pain, muscle weakness, and persistent fatigue. Some individuals may also experience mood fluctuations or depressive symptoms, given the role of vitamin D in mental health. If you are experiencing these symptoms, it may be wise to consider undergoing a vitamin D blood test to assess your levels.
Moreover, frequent infections, prolonged illnesses, or slow recovery from injuries can also signify a deficiency. Being proactive about your health and recognising these signs can lead to timely testing and intervention, ultimately enhancing your quality of life.

Understanding the Costs Associated with Vitamin D Testing
The cost of a vitamin D blood test in Mansfield can fluctuate significantly based on whether you utilise NHS services or opt for private providers. NHS tests may be offered at no charge, particularly for individuals deemed at risk of deficiency. Conversely, private testing services typically charge between £30 and £100, depending on the facility and the test’s level of detail.
